The Setup: Bet, Speed, and the Countdown
Your first task is simple: decide how much you want to risk.
You can wager as little as €0.10 or go all‑in with €1,000 if you’re feeling daring—but remember that higher bets also mean bigger potential losses.
Next comes speed selection—four levels ranging from slow (lowest risk) to turbo (highest risk). The speed you pick is the only lever you have to influence how long your flight lasts and how many multipliers you’ll hit.
Once you’ve set your bet and speed, hit “Play.” The counter balance will rise instantly as you see multipliers pop up on screen.
- Set bet amount
- Select speed level
- Press “Play”
- Watch the counter grow
- Decide when to cash out
The countdown feels like a mini‑race against time—exactly what fuels short‑session excitement.
The Flight: Multipliers, Rockets, and Heartbeat
The flight is where adrenaline spikes.
As your plane whizzes across the screen, multipliers appear—+1, +2, +5, +10 or x2, x3, x4, x5—each adding to your potential payout.
Rockets occasionally fire from below; each one halves your collected amount and nudges your trajectory downward.
You can’t control these events—only your speed choice and the moment you decide to cash out matter.
- Multipliers: Randomly add value; higher multipliers bring larger potential wins.
- Rockets: Reduce winnings by half; increase tension.
- Counter Balance: Shows real‑time winnings above the plane.
This mix of chance and visual drama keeps you glued for those brief but intense minutes.
Speed Matters: Choosing the Right Turbulence Level
If you’re after quick wins, picking the right speed feels like choosing your own risk profile.
A lower speed gives you more time to collect multipliers but reduces potential gains because the plane travels more slowly.
A turbo speed forces rapid accumulation but also increases the likelihood of rockets hitting before you can secure a high multiplier.
Many players start at normal speed (level 2) to gauge how quickly they can reach decent multipliers before deciding whether to push harder.
- SLOW: Minimal risk; modest gains.
- NORMAL: Balanced risk‑reward; good for quick learning.
- FAST: Higher reward potential; more rockets.
- TURBO: Highest risk; chance of big wins if lucky.
Your choice should align with how many seconds you’re willing to spend per round.
